Are you curious about angel investment?

In this episode of The Business Ownership Podcast I interviewed Marcia Dawood. Marcia is an angel investor, TEDx Speaker, authour, podcast host and, SEC Advisory Committee. She is an early-stage investor who serves on the Securities and Exchange Commission’s Small Business Capital Formation Advisory Committee. Marcia is a venture partner with Mindshift Capital, a member of Golden Seeds, and the Chair Emeritus of the Angel Capital Association (ACA), the global professional society for angel investors.

Discover the strategies that can change the game for underrepresented founders and learn how even small contributions can make a big impact.
